Section 13 — Power for Local Government to make regulations.

The Sarais' Act, 1867
The Local Government may from time to time make regulations for the better attainment of the objects of this Act, provided that such rules be not inconsistent with this Act or with any other law for the time being in force, and may from time to time repeal, alter and add to the same. All regulations made under this Act and all repeals thereof, and alterations and additions thereto, shall be published in the Local official Gazette .
